What to See on This Route
Yamunotri (3,293 m)
source of the Yamuna; 6 km trek from Janki Chatti
Gangotri (3,415 m)
source of the Ganga; 3 km trek to Gaumukh glacier
Kedarnath (3,583 m)
Shiva's holiest jyotirlinga; 16 km trek from Gaurikund
Badrinath (3,133 m)
Lord Vishnu's abode; flat access, no major trek
Mana Village
last Indian village, 3 km beyond Badrinath at the Tibet border
All Char Dham visitors must register at the official Char Dham Yatra portal (devasthanam board website). Biometric registration mandatory at Dehradun or Haridwar camp.
Travel Tips: Dehradun to Char Dham Circuit
Start the circuit Dehradun → Yamunotri → Gangotri (Garhwal west) → Kedarnath → Badrinath (east) — this is the traditional clockwise order.
Book helicopter tickets for Kedarnath at least 3 weeks in advance in peak season (May, June, September).
Altitude sickness prevention: stay one night at Uttarkashi (for Gangotri) and at Guptkashi (for Kedarnath) to acclimatise.
Carry prescription medicines, warm clothing rated to -5°C, rain gear, and comfortable trekking shoes.

How many days does the Char Dham Yatra take from Dehradun?
A comfortable Char Dham Yatra from Dehradun takes 10–12 days: 2 days for Yamunotri, 2 days for Gangotri, 2 days for Kedarnath (including trek), 2 days for Badrinath, and 1–2 days of travel buffer.
Which vehicle is best for Char Dham Yatra?
The Toyota Innova Crysta (8-seater SUV) is the most popular vehicle for Char Dham. It has the best combination of ground clearance, engine power for steep grades, luggage capacity, and passenger comfort for long mountain days.
What is the best month for Char Dham Yatra?
September and October are the best months for Char Dham Yatra. The monsoon has passed, roads are clear, queues are shorter than May–June, and visibility of the Himalayan peaks is excellent.
